Good evening.

This week we worked on education and political stories from across the state.

That included a heated school board meeting in Clarksville where parents demanded answers, to a State Board of Education vote that could change graduation requirements.

We also have another poll showing strong support for one candidate in this year's governor's race and an exclusive Firefly investigation into suburban school districts that opposed legislation that would have made it easier for families to enroll their children in schools outside of their zoned district.

Clarksville Parents Criticize Support Following Fatal School Bus Crash

Parents called out the district for a lack of accountability, transparency, and support for grieving families impacted by the crash.
